Brief description of the notified legal text

 

Governing legislation for plant varieties protection

 

-        A new Section 17A has been inserted related to Corresponding Examination which provides that an applicant may, instead of complying with section 17, lodge with the Registrar in such manner as the Registrar may require and within the prescribed period, an examination report issued and certified by the examination authorities in any UPOV member other than Brunei Darussalam. However, the Registrar may reject this examination report lodged under subsection (1), in which case the applicant shall comply with section 17.
